    i'll take a slab of wax with a crap ton of loops over a "filler" tune anyday. and i understand what you mean rhythmtech, it's just that what djs consider "tools" are useful to djs and djs only. and that's partly why the labels are suffering from low sales. we have developed a niche market that has, frankly, built itself upon the disposability and subsequent acquisition-fuelled mindset of "dj tools". and when djs are the ones buying this stuff, and djs stop buying it cuz they are bored...well the whole thing takes a big poo.

    we have built a "closed loop" system that is killing itself.

    just my three cents...
